INTACT

WORD: INTACT

MEANING:
1. Remaining sound, entire, or uninjured; not impaired in any way.
2. Having all physical parts, especially:
a. Having the hymen unbroken.
b. Not castrated.
3. Whole, Entire, Complete.

EXAMPLE/USAGE:
1. Fortunately, the singer’s voice is still intact after her throat surgery

PRONOUNCE:
in·tact - इन्टैक्ट
